Meditation Tips for Releasing Long-Term Frustration from Your Body


Long-term frustration can accumulate in the body, causing physical tension and emotional unrest. Meditation is an effective tool to help release this burden and restore balance.

Understanding Long-Term Frustration in the Body.


Frustration held over time often manifests as muscle tightness, headaches, or a general sense of restlessness. These physical symptoms can undermine mental clarity and emotional peace.

Preparing for Meditation.


1 Select a Quiet Space: Find a serene environment where you can sit comfortably without interruptions.
2 Set Your Intention: Begin your practice by mentally stating, "I release this long-term frustration from my body."
3 Choose a Comfortable Posture: Sit or lie down in a way that keeps your body relaxed yet alert.

 Techniques to Release Frustration.


1. Focused Breathing: Use slow, deep breaths to calm your nervous system. Inhale through your nose, pause briefly, and exhale fully through your mouth.
2. Body Scan Meditation: Gradually bring your attention to different parts of your body, noticing areas of tension. Breathe into these spots and imagine the tension melting away.
3. Visualization: Picture the frustration as a dark cloud leaving your body, replaced by a warm, healing light bringing calm.
4. Mantra or Affirmations: Silently repeat phrases such as "I am calm," or "I release all tension," helping to center your mind.

Maintaining a Meditation Practice.


Consistency is key to experiencing lasting benefits. Start with 10 minutes daily and gradually increase your session time as comfortable. Pair meditation with gentle yoga, Ayurvedic self-care, or mindful journaling for enhanced effects.

Releasing long-term frustration through meditation nurtures both mind and body. This practice fosters emotional clarity, physical relaxation, and spiritual balance. Embrace meditation as a daily ritual to transform frustration into calm and resilience.
